This fact sheet addresses the fact that farmers are concerned about insect damage to sweet potato roots in commercial potato fields. Many farmers growing sweet potatoes for the first time don’t use insecticides, and insect damage occurs long before harvest. Unfortunately, not much can be done at harvest time to rectify damage which has already occurred, especially with a late October harvest. As the soil temperature drops, so does the activity of root-feeding insects.
